About S. Basilio

From the terminal at S. Basilio, the local public transport operator ACTV runs a total of 9 domestic routes to six nearby destinations within Venice. All crossings are very short, with journey times ranging from just 3 to 5 minutes. This makes the port a key interchange for rapid local travel.

S. Basilio Ferry Routes and Destinations

Services connect S. Basilio directly with Giudecca Palanca "B" and S. Marta. There are also frequent departures for Sacca Fisola, stopping at both Sacca Fisola "A" and Sacca Fisola "B". The remaining connections serve two separate stops at Zattere, designated Zattere "A" and Zattere "B".

ACTV is the sole operator for all services originating from or arriving at this location. Given the very short transit times of 3 to 5 minutes, these routes function as a water bus service, linking points across the Giudecca Canal and connecting the districts of Dorsoduro and Giudecca.
